DOM แท็ก table
property
border
caption
cellPadding
cellSpacing
className
id
rules
summary
width

border รับหรือตั้งค่าขอบของ table
ตัวอย่าง
<table id="table1" border="1">
<tr><td>a</td></tr>
<tr><td>b</td></tr>
</table>

<script type="text/javascript">
document.all.table1.border="5";
</script>

จากตัวอย่างจะกำหนดขอบให้เท่ากับ 5 pixels


caption รับหรือตั้งค่าขอบของ table
ตัวอย่าง
<table id="table1">
<caption>caption ของ table</caption>
<tr><td>a</td></tr>
<tr><td>b</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.caption.innerHTML);
</script>

จากตัวอย่างจะพิมพ์ข้อความ caption


cellPadding รับหรือตั้งค่าความห่างจากขอบภายในช่องของ table
ตัวอย่าง
<table id="table1" cellpadding="10">
<caption>caption ของ table</caption>
<tr><td>a</td></tr>
<tr><td>b</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.cellpadding);
</script>

จากตัวอย่างจะพิมพ์ค่าของ cellpadding


cellSpacing รับหรือตั้งค่าขนาดของเส้นแบ่งในตาราง table
ตัวอย่าง
<table id="table1" cellspacing="10">
<caption>caption ของ table</caption>
<tr><td>a</td></tr>
<tr><td>b</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.cellspacing);
</script>

จากตัวอย่างจะพิมพ์ค่าของ cellspacing


className รับหรือตั้งค่าของ class
ตัวอย่าง
<table id="table1" cellspacing="10" class="class1">
<caption>caption ของ table</caption>
<tr><td>a</td></tr>
<tr><td>b</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.className);
</script>

จากตัวอย่างจะพิมพ์ค่าของ className


id กำหนดหรือรับค่าid
ตัวอย่าง

<table id="table1" cellspacing="10" class="class1">
<caption>caption ของ table</caption>
<tr><td>a</td></tr>
<tr><td>b</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.id);
</script>

จากตัวอย่างจะพิมพ์ข้อความว่า table1


rules กำหนดหรือรับค่า rules ซึ่งเป็นการกำหนดลักษณะของเส้นภายในตาราง
ตัวอย่าง

<script type="text/javascript">
function changeRules(){
document.all.table1.rules="none";
}
</script>

<table id="table1" cellspacing="10" border="1">
<caption>caption ของ table</caption>
<tr><td>a</td><td>b</td></tr>
<tr><td>c</td><td>d</td></tr>
</table>
<input type="button" onclick="changeRules()" value="chang Rules ">

ค่าที่เป็นไปได้คือ none|groups|rows|cols|all


summary กำหนดหรือรับค่า summary ซึ่งเป็นการกำหนดข้อความบรรยายของตาราง
ตัวอย่าง

<table id="table1" cellspacing="10" border="1" summary="SUMMARY OF TABLE" >
<caption>caption ของ table</caption>
<tr><td>a</td><td>b</td></tr>
<tr><td>c</td><td>d</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.summary);
</script>

จากตัวอย่างจะพิมพ์ข้อความว่า SUMMARY OF TABLE


width กำหนดหรือรับค่าความกว้างของตาราง
ตัวอย่าง

<table id="table1" width="200" cellspacing="10" border="1" summary="SUMMARY OF TABLE">
<caption>caption ของ table</caption>
<tr><td>a</td><td>b</td></tr>
<tr><td>c</td><td>d</td></tr>
</table>

<script type="text/javascript">
document.write(document.all.table1.width);
</script>

จากตัวอย่างจะพิมพ์ข้อความว่า SUMMARY OF TABLE



menu DOM